PowerColor Radeon RX Vega 56 Nano Edition
vs
ASUS EKWB GeForce RTX 3070


GPU comparison with benchmarks

The PowerColor Radeon RX Vega 56 Nano Edition is based on the AMD RX Vega 56 (GCN 5) and has 8 GB HBM2 graphics memory with a bandwidth of 410 GB/s.

The ASUS EKWB GeForce RTX 3070 is based on the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3070 (Ampere) and has 8 GB GDDR6 graphics memory with a bandwidth of 448 GB/s.

GPU

The PowerColor Radeon RX Vega 56 Nano Edition has the Vega 10 XL graphics chip installed, which is based on the GCN 5 architecture.

The ASUS EKWB GeForce RTX 3070 is based on the graphics chip GA104-300-A1, which comes from the Ampere architecture.

Memory

The graphics memory of the PowerColor Radeon RX Vega 56 Nano Edition clocks at 0.800 GHz, which corresponds to a speed of 1.6 Gbps.

The graphics memory speed of the ASUS EKWB GeForce RTX 3070 is 14.0 Gbps and the clock speed is 1.750 GHz.

Thermal Design

The PowerColor Radeon RX Vega 56 Nano Edition is powered by 1 x 6-Pin, 1 x 8-Pin connectors. The TDP (Thermal Design Power) of the graphics card is 210 W.

The ASUS EKWB GeForce RTX 3070 has 2 x 8-Pin PCIe power connectors that supply it with energy. The manufacturer specifies the TDP of the card as 220 W.

Dimensions

The PowerColor Radeon RX Vega 56 Nano Edition is connected to the system via PCIe 3.0 x 16 lanes and requires 2 PCIe-Slots space in the housing.

The ASUS EKWB GeForce RTX 3070 needs the space of 1 PCIe-Slots in the case and has a PCIe 4.0 x 16 Lanes interface.

Additional data

The PowerColor Radeon RX Vega 56 Nano Edition has been manufactured with a structure width of 14 nanometers since Q3/2017.

The ASUS EKWB GeForce RTX 3070 came on the market in Q4/2020 and will have a structure width of 8 nanometers manufactured.
